The Pixel Lit Podcast is the top podcast in the world for video game novelizations. Every episode, we read, recap, and discuss works of fiction based on and in the worlds of your favorite video games. And don’t worry: we take it very, very seriously. Join hosts Kevin and Phil as they talk about novelizations and adaptations of games like Halo, Five Nights at Freddie’s, Dead Space, Ninja Gaiden, and many more–all while keeping their attention firmly on the topic and hand, and never ever getting off topic.

Hey we are back with a brand new book. This time it's Driver: Nemesis by Alex Sharp. Who is Alex Sharp? No idea, couldn't find any information on them. How's the book? Well it reads like a book you wouldn't necessarily put your name on. So that tracks.
